For anyone with issues of high blood sugar level, such as those with diabetes mellitus or prediabetes, it is helpful to stay clear of high carbohydrate foods as much as possible, particularly since they can cause spikes in blood glucose levels instantly after consuming whereas the lower carbohydrate foods cause an even more moderate elevation in blood glucose.

The main nutrients, proteins, fats, and carbohydrates (referred to below by their accepted abbreviated kind as carbs) are essential to maintain life. The purpose of this short article is define the difference in between low carbohydrate diet foods and also low carbohydrate foods, specifically because a low carbohydrate diet plan, while including a little proportion of carbohydrates could consist of very few carbs that could be correctly defined as being "low".

Low carbohydrate diets refer only to the proportion of carbohydrate foods in a diet plan in regard to the proportions of the various other primary nutrients, healthy proteins and fats. The low carbohydrate diets probably comprise less than 20 or 25 percent of overall daily calories whereas a much more regular diet plan, carbs can be 50 percent or more of overall day-to-day calories. Those percents differ with different prominent diet advocates yet the principal is the same, low carbohydrate diet recipes refer to the low percentage of carbs in the daily diet.

Low carbohydrate foods on the other hand are those food products that provide a smaller amount of glucose to the body than do the greater carb foods. As an example, meat consisting of poultry, fish, as well as some dairy foods have little or no carbohydrates, (although milk products do have some carbs). So those might be better called non-carb or almost non-carb foods.

Instances of real everyday low carbohydrate foods would be the entire grain breads, breakfast bran cereals as well as oatmeal, many veggies but not potatoes, the majority of fruits, the majority of beans, actually there are a huge variety of wholesome foods that can be classified as low carb foods. High carb foods, for a comparison, are those food items that offer a larger amount of glucose to the body promptly than do the lower carbohydrate foods. A few instances of high carb foods are: white bread, burger buns, Kellog's Corn Flakes and Rice Krispies, white rice, potatoes and French french fries, chocolate bars and also candy bars, and there are a lot more.

Some instances of low carbohydrate foods are:

Veggies: cabbage, cauliflower, broccoli, spinach, lettuce, asparagus, mushrooms, beans, tomatoes, cucumber, celery, onions, eggplant, etc

. Fresh fruits as well as berries (moist fruits): rather higher in carbs compared to veggies yet still identified as low carbohydrate foods. Apricots, peaches, apples, plums, pears, cherries, grapes, strawberries, blackberries, raspberries, melon, watermelon, etc

. Nuts: peanuts, cashews, almonds, brazil nuts, pecans, walnuts, hazel nuts, sunflower seeds, pumpkin seeds, macadamia nuts, etc

. Breads as well as grains: entire wheat breads, soy and also flaxseed bread, entire grain pumpernickel, All Bran, Bran Buds, Oat Meal, Cheerios, Alpen Muesli, etc

. Milk items: several cheeses however not all, butter, lotion, eggs, etc. It should be noted that dairy items are commonly high in fat so must be eaten in moderation.

Drinks: fruit and tomato juices, wine and alcohol in small amounts.

A healthy diet consists of a balance of carbohydrate foods along with healthy proteins and fats, the proportions suggested by numerous nutritional experts are 50:25:25, indicating HALF carbs, 25 percent proteins and also 25 percent fats without more than 10 percent of the fats being hydrogenated fats.
